About gtechna

gtechna is a leading provider of software solutions for parking management, law enforcement, and municipal code enforcement operations.

For more than 20 years, we have helped police departments, municipalities, and public sector organizations across North America improve operational efficiency through innovative and proven technology solutions.

Today, more than 150 organizations rely on gtechna, including:

  • Washington, D.C.

  • Toronto Police Service

  • Montreal Police Service

  • Baltimore, Maryland

  • Vancouver, British Columbia

Beyond software development, gtechna is recognized for the quality of its operations and its strong customer relationships.

Position Summary

As a Legal Intern, the successful candidate will support the Legal team with a variety of legal, administrative, and research-related tasks. The individual will assist with document preparation, contract management, and day-to-day legal operations while gaining valuable hands-on experience in a dynamic and fast-paced technology environment.

Responsibilities

  • Build and maintain a summary file to improve the management of our 192 customer contracts.

  • Provide administrative support to the Legal team.

  • Assist with the organization and management of legal files and documentation.

  • Conduct research on a variety of legal, contractual, and administrative topics.

  • Assist with drafting, reviewing, and updating legal and administrative documents.

  • Contribute to improving document and contract management processes.

  • Support the team with various related duties as required.

Qualifications

  • Currently enrolled in a Law, Business Administration, or related program.

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.

  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ills.

  • Ability to manage multiple priorities effectively.

  • Strong analytical and research skills.

  • Eagerness to learn and develop professionally.

  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ications.
